Chemical Engineering is the 70th most popular major in the country with 12,917 degrees awarded in 2020-2021. In 2019-2020, chemical engineering gra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$65,870 and had an average of $23,285 in loans still to pay off.

Across New York, there were 870 chemical eng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$62,417 and $23,332 respectively.

This year’s “Best Value Chem Eng Schools in New York For Those Making $75-$110k” ranking analyzed 12 colleges that offered a degree in chemical engineering. This ranking identifies schools with high-quality chemical engineering programs that also have a lower cost than schools of similar quality.

To come up with these rankings, we looked at factors such as the cost to attend the school after aid is awarded and overall quality of the chemical engineering program at the school. See our ranking methodology to learn more.

Out of the 12 schools in the Best Value Chem Eng Schools in New York For Those Making $75-$110k that were part of this year’s ranking, Columbia University in the City of New York landed the #1 spot on the list. This large school is located in New York, New York, and it awarded 114 ’s chem eng degrees in 2020-2021.

Columbia not only placed well in this ranking. It is also #2 on our “Best Chemical Engineering Schools in New York” list. The yearly cost to attend Columbia is $16,916 for new york chem eng students whose families make $75-$110k.

The low undergrad student loan default rate of 1.7%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%. Students who start out at the school are likely to stick around. The freshman retention rate is 95%. With a undergrad student-to-faculty ratio of 6 to 1, it’s easy to see that the school is committed to helping their undergraduates succeed.

Cornell University
Ithaca, New York

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Cornell University. The school came in at #2 for the Best Value Chem Eng Schools in New York For Those Making $75-$110k. Located in Ithaca, New York, this large private not-for-profit school awarded 131 diplomas to qualified ’s chem eng students in 2020-2021.

Cornell did well in our major quality rankings, too. It placed #1 on our “Best Chemical Engineering Schools in New York” list. The estimated yearly cost for Cornell is $21,043 for new york chem eng students whose families make $75-$110k.

The undergrad student loan default rate at the school is 0.9%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%. With a freshman retention rate of 96%, the school does an excellent job of retaining its undergraduate students. The impressive undergraduate student-to-faculty ratio of 9 to 1 means that students may have more opportunities to work more closely with their professors than they would at other schools.
